Transaction a2e66f372b2f170381f51ea20383b86c4097c45b3a02372c230b3b8451e229f2

3 Input
2 Outputs
  • a2e66f372b2f170381f51ea20383b86c4097c45b3a02372c230b3b8451e229f2:0
  • value  25321299
    address  3AVbsg6ySbVr5kNtH94YjvJ6Fthux56dnk
  • a2e66f372b2f170381f51ea20383b86c4097c45b3a02372c230b3b8451e229f2:1
  • value  477673
    address  14EuaWUqJHfVxsE3dqarWetP8gSsah3kpz